Temporary Optical Engineer Intern information
What is the difference between Temporary Optical Engineer Intern vs Optical Engineer?
| Aspect | Temporary Optical Engineer Intern | Optical Engineer |
|---|---|---|
| Credentials | Typically pursuing or recent graduate in optics, physics, or engineering | Bachelor's or master's degree in optics, physics, or related field; professional experience preferred |
| Work Environment | Internship setting, often in research labs or corporate R&D departments | Full-time professional role in labs, manufacturing, or R&D teams |
| Employer & Industry | Tech companies, research institutions, or manufacturing firms | Optics, photonics, telecommunications, or consumer electronics industries |
The main difference between a Temporary Optical Engineer Intern and an Optical Engineer lies in experience, responsibilities, and employment status. Interns are usually students gaining practical experience, while Optical Engineers are full-time professionals with advanced skills and responsibilities.

Interns will have the opportunity to work as part of a dynamic team under the guidance of experienced engineers. You may be called upon to perform a variety of engineering and construction management tasks. The intern will be placed in one of the three areas: office intern, field intern and estimating intern.
You will be responsible for the following tasks:
Field engineering, operation planning, cost control, project scheduling, quantity tracking, material procurement, contract administration, estimating & supervision of field activities.
Performing engineering tasks requiring standard techniques and handling minor problems of a technical nature arising during construction
Maintaining records as required regarding job progress, costs, material usage, etc.
Planning and scheduling of job and/or job segments.
Investigating problems and/or reported incidents, identifying, and recommending solutions/alternatives as appropriate.
Reviewing plans and specifications to determine material requirements (quantities and qualities), pricing of materials, etc.
Working with suppliers as required facilitating the handling and expediting delivery of materials.
Estimation of costs for large-scale projects
Use of several software (Hard Dollar, AutoCAD, P6, InRoads etc.)
